PETALING JAYA: This is not the right time to increase the set minimum wage, says the security industry.
Security Industry Association of Malaysia (PIKM) president Datuk Seri Ramli Yusuff, referring to recent statements from Human Resources Minister Datuk Seri M. Saravanan, said that if the plan went ahead, many members of the association would be forced to cease operation due to losses.
